Yesterday to my big surprise I could copy K5P on 160m for about 30 minutes, seemed to peak around 1445Z. They where as strong as 559 on the peaks with deep QSB. I never ever was thinking it was possible to even hear them the way 160m is these days. However they does not seem to RX very well. Me and OH6KN and one or two others was calling but K5P mostly was calling CQ. Big problem also was that the K5P operator never did announce the RX frequency, he seemed to listen both up and down. I am sorry but this is a very bad way of operating.

Dear OMs, Please do not think I am criticizing the team. So far at 17:27 GMT on Jan16 there has only been one 160M QSO with zone 14 which includes EI, G, DL etc. The propagation gods are not favouring us at all. K5P is a hard reach on most bands and once you go away from 17 through 40 meters there are literally only about five QSOs total on the other bands. Some are losing their reason and making poor comments which reflect badly on both them and their nations. We as a hobby need to do better in recognizing the troubles of the DXpedition. 73 Doug EI2CN
